directions

  • Stir first 8 ingredients together in large bowl.
  • Add warm water and cooking oil.
  • Mix.
  • Work in enough remaining flour until dough pulls away from sides of bowl.
  • Turn out onto floured surface.
  • Knead about 4 minutes.
  • Place in greased bowl, turning once to grease top.
  • Cover with tea towel.
  • Let stand in oven with light on and door closed for about 1 1/2 hours until doubled in bulk.
  • Punch dough down.
  • Cut dough into egg-sized pieces.
  • Shape into buns.
  • Set aside momemtarily.
  • Topping:Beat egg and water with fork in small bowl.
  • Stir next 4 ingredients together in another bowl.
  • Brush top of each bun with egg wash, dip in seeds and arrange on greased baking sheet at least 1 inch apart.
  • Cover with tea towel.
  • Let stand in oven with light on and door closed for about 45 minutes until doubled in size.
  • Bake in 375 degree oven for about 20 minutes.
  • Turn out onto racks to cool.
